Pattaya releases 10,000 marine animals for World Environment Day

Representatives from Central Festival Pattaya Beach join Mayor Itthiphol Kunplome in releasing blue crab and white perch into to the sea.

Phasakorn Channgam
Pattaya officials released 10,000 fish and crabs into the sea as the city marked World Environment Day.
Mayor Itthiphol Kunplome presided over the June 4 event, a day before the official United Nations celebration to raise awareness about environmental conservation, food shortages, energy crises and population growth.
City workers joined staff of area hotels, the Naklua Bay Conservation Group, students and teachers at Jomtien Beach, where they picked up garbage and cleaned the shoreline. Workers from the city Public Health and Environment Department’s Natural Resources Office then released the white perch, blue crabs and other species of marine life.
